Output e62b03be51bffb4cc9a9717517a86f26a79ca62a17b8567b084bb521bc6e3f95:0

value
586908
script pubkey
OP_0 OP_PUSHBYTES_20 bdac5897bb446b853b8dee41f19005d75d82efa0
address
bc1qhkk939amg34c2wudaeqlryq96awc9maqx34q63
transaction
e62b03be51bffb4cc9a9717517a86f26a79ca62a17b8567b084bb521bc6e3f95
spent
true